Adam Gilchrist, the Australian wicketkeeper and batsman who has now since retired, yes the same Adam Gilchrist who in his autobiography True Colours had called Sachin Tendulkar and Harbhajan names regarding the Symonds’ incident, has now truly changed his colours.
Adam is being very caring and protective of the new batting sensation, the young David Warner. David showed great promise in his debut striking 80 runs off 43 balls against South Africa in Twenty20 match.
But unfortunately David, hailed as a new upcoming star in cricketosphere,was unable to give repeat performance. Here Adam has stepped in advising David not to think of his first debut knock while going in for batting in the third one day match against South Africa. Also like a counsellor giving advice to a nervous student, he told David not to think about the expectations which everyone has from him. He should not carry the burden of expectations on the pitch tomorrow.
Very sagely he told David that it is not possible to play excellently every time and make runs,it does not work every time.
Relax, play as naturally as he normally does and then there will be runs and runs,was the veteran’s advice.
